§ 16-60-204. Procedure when order granted -- Transmission of papers -- Fees

AR Code § 16-60-204 (2018) (N/A)
Copy with citation
Copy as parenthetical citation

(a) When the order for change of venue is obtained out of term time, the party obtaining the order shall cause the petition, notice, affidavit, and order to be delivered to the clerk of the court in which the action is pending, who shall file the order with the papers in the case.

(b)

(1) In all cases where an order for a change of venue is granted, the clerk shall make and file with the papers a certified copy of all the orders in the case and, upon the payment of the transmission fees provided for in this section, shall transmit the papers in the case to the clerk of the court to which the venue is changed by any safe and convenient mode which he or she may select.

(2) The clerk shall be responsible for the transmission of the papers, for which he or she shall receive ten cents (10cent(s)) per mile to and from the clerk's office, to be paid by the party obtaining the order, and to be taxed in the costs.

(c)

(1) If the above-mentioned fee is not paid or arranged with the clerk within fifteen (15) days from the granting of the order, the order shall be null and void.

(2) The judge granting the order may extend the time of making such payment, which shall be stated in the order.

(3) The adverse party, if he or she chooses, may make such payment.
